Dry Contacts
DANGER
HAZARD OF ELECTRIC SHOCK, EXPLOSION, OR ARC FLASH
•
Use 600 Vac rated dry contact wiring.
•
Dry contact wiring must have less than 1/16 in. (1.6 mm) exposed wire from the dry contact block.
•
Do not supply more than 24 V dc / 24 V ac and no more than a current of 2 A.
Failure to follow these instructions will result in death or serious injury.
The SolaHD 200K/300K series SPD is provided with dry contacts. The connection for the dry contacts is
located on the inside of the SPD enclosure and will accept # 22 - 14 AWG stranded or solid wire. The dry
contacts are three-position, Form “C” type with Normally Open, Normally Closed, and Common connections.
In the unpowered state the contact is closed between terminals NC and COM. This is also the alarm condition.
The opposite state, closed between terminals NO and COM, indicates that power is on to the unit and that no
alarm condition exists.

These contacts can be used for remote indication of the SPD’s operating status to a computer interface board
or emergency management system. Also, these contacts are designed to work with the SPD remote monitor
option described in the next section.
Table 3: Dry Contact Configuration
Alarm Contact Terminals
Contact State with Power Applied
NO to COM
Closed
NC to COM
Open
The dry contacts are designed for a maximum voltage of 24 Vdc / 24 Vac and a maximum current of 2 A. For
